JASPAR 2022: the 9th release of the open-access database of transcription factor binding profiles

Jaime A. Castro-Mondragon et al.

Summary: JASPAR is an open-access database containing manually curated, non-redundant transcription factor binding profiles across six taxonomic groups. The latest release introduces new profiles for plants, vertebrates, urochordates, and insects, as well as new tools for TFBS enrichment analysis and data access. The database can be accessed through various platforms, including the JASPAR website, RESTful API, R/Bioconductor data package, and a new Python package pyJASPAR.

Activation of stably silenced genes by recruitment of a synthetic de-methylating module

Wing Fuk Chan et al.

Summary: By coupling the catalytic domain of DNA demethylating enzyme TET1 with transcriptional activators (TETact), the authors have developed an improved activation system that can induce transcription of stably silenced genes. The TETact system is applicable in various cell types and has the ability to reactivate embryonic haemoglobin genes in non-erythroid cells. It is expected that TETact will have significant implications in functional studies, genetic screens, and potential therapeutics.

AP-1 family transcription factors: a diverse family of proteins that regulate varied cellular activities in classical hodgkin lymphoma and ALK plus ALCL

Zuoqiao Wu et al.

Summary: Classical Hodgkin lymphoma (cHL) and anaplastic lymphoma kinase-positive, anaplastic large cell lymphoma (ALK+ ALCL) are B and T cell lymphomas that express CD30 and show aberrant expression of AP-1 family of transcription factors. These proteins play various roles in promoting proliferation, suppressing apoptosis, and evading host immune response. Therapeutic strategies targeting AP-1 transcriptional targets or the signaling pathways they regulate are being explored for the treatment of these lymphomas.

PRC1 drives Polycomb-mediated gene repression by controlling transcription initiation and burst frequency

Paula Dobrinic et al.

Summary: The authors discovered that the Polycomb repressive complex PRC1 functions independently of PRC2 to counteract Pol II binding and regulate transcription initiation by controlling transcriptional burst frequency. This finding provides a mechanistic and conceptual framework for Polycomb-dependent transcriptional control.
